A Circular Decree of the State Council Concerning Strict Protection of Precious and Rare Wild Animals
(Decree No. 62 [1983] of the State Council, April 13, 1983)
Ours is a country which has the largest varieties of wild animals in the world, accounting for over 10% of the world's total number of varieties of wild animals. Among these wild animals are giant panda, golden monkey, Taiwan monkey, takin, Cervus albirostris, Muntiacus crinifrons, Chinese river dolphin (Lipotes vexillifer), Chinese alligator, Acipenser sinensis, Chinese paddlefish, Crossoptilon mantchuricum, jacana, and black-necked crane, and others --- a total of more than 100 species of precious and rare wild animals, well known to the world and found exclusively in our country. Besides those mentioned above, there are some wild animals, such as red-crowned crane, white crane, red ibis, Ciconia nigra, swan, yellow-ventraled horned jacana, green-tailed jacana, white-crowned long-tailed pheasant, gibbon, black-leaf monkey, tufted deer, snow leopard, and wild camel, which are species of precious and rare wild animals on the brink of extinction. Wild animals are valuable natural resources of our country, but for a long time, owing to various reasons, these natural resources have been faced with the danger of being exhausted. The protection and rational utilization of these natural resources are of great significance in maintaining ecological balance, carrying on scientific research, developing national economy, and promoting the development of culture, education, medicine, and public health. In the past few years, cases of hunting precious and rare wild animals, seriously destroying the habitats of these wild animals, and the illegal acts of exporting these animals and products made from them, have been frequently reported in various places.

国务院关于严格保护珍贵稀有野生动物的通令
(1983年4月13日 国发[1983]62号)


我国是世界上拥有野生动物种类最多的国家,占世界种类总数百分之十以上。其中大熊猫、金丝猴、台湾猴、羚牛、白唇鹿、黑麂、白鳍豚、扬子鳄、中华鲟、白鲟、褐马鸡、雉鹑、黑颈鹤等一百多种是闻名世界的我国特产珍贵稀有野生动物。此外,还有丹顶鹤、白鹤、朱?、黑鹳、天鹅、黄腹角雉、绿尾虹雉、白冠长尾雉、多种长臂猿、叶猴、毛冠鹿、雪豹、野骆驼等珍稀濒危种类的野生动物野生动物是我国一项宝贵的自然资源,长期以来由于多方面的原因,使这项自然资源面临枯竭的危险。保护及合理利用这项资源,对维护自然生态平衡,开展科学研究,发展经济、文化、教育、医药、卫生等事业有着重要意义;近几年来,不少地区仍发生猎捕珍贵稀有野生动物,严重破坏这些动物的栖息环境事件,以及违章出口这些动物及其产品等违法行为。
